Output 65ebb07e04aa938b0015ddaf13b3e28ec7f83f8685428914d152b9b1c8695706:0

value
2356253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ef4c8d260fd30ded195ebaa8ee4a7a8ba529d174 OP_EQUAL
address
3PWK8GnyXauAjNFRCzMuQdnULwp4F94e1d
transaction
65ebb07e04aa938b0015ddaf13b3e28ec7f83f8685428914d152b9b1c8695706
spent
true